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5713 68363 485960785
53317678637 5941
53317678637 5941
953604 103 34186 76 022
All about undefined
Interested in learning more?
53317678637 5941
953604 103 34186 76 022
See more
3388834645 00944621076 71071
376 4911845020 733 677646784 43
See more
130499192 528626249
461 0311669547 08 9720660415
See more